Manual de usuario de la aplicación para la resolución de problemas del viajante de comercio o TSP

Introducción

El usuario podrá introducir los valores correspondientes a las distancias entre las ciudades que desee y visualizar, en forma de grafo etiquetado, la solución del Problema del Viajante de Comercio asociado a dichos datos.

Esta aplicación calcula la ruta más corta posible entre el conjunto de ciudades que hayan sido introducidas. Dicha ruta consiste en pasar por cada una de las ciudades en una sola ocasión, hasta acabar regresando a la ciudad de la que partimos inicialmente.

La estructura de la aplicación se organiza en cuatro pestañas:

  • Información: en la que se detalla toda la información necesaria sobre la aplicación
  • Datos: la cual muestra el conjunto de datos cargados en la aplicación
  • Gráficos: dónde podremos contemplar de manera gráfica nuestra solución
  • Solución: la cual muestra la solución del problema

Uso de la aplicación

En primer lugar, introduzca los datos en la aplicación. Estos datos deberán ser introducidos a partir de un fichero .csv, dicho archivo debe organizarse en cuatro columnas diferenciadas que se detallan a continuación:

  • En la primera columna del fichero se incluirán, de forma ordenada, los nombres de cada una de las distintas ciudades.
  • En las tres columnas restantes, se describirán cada uno de los distintos caminos que forman parte del problema. Distribuido en filas, en cada una de ellas tendremos la siguiente información:
    • El origen del camino, expresado por el número correspondiente a su posición, \( i \).
    • El destino, con su posición correspondiente, \( j \).
    • y la distancia de dicho camino, \( d \).

Una vez introducidos los datos, seleccione la acción que desee: cargar los datos o modificar aquellos que desee. Además también dispone de la opción de introducir nuevos valores.

Una vez seleccionada la acción, pulse Hacer, en cuyo caso la aplicación procederá a resolver el Problema del Viajante de Comercio asociado a los datos cargados.

Pestaña de información

En la pestaña Datos podrá visualizar el conjunto de datos que ha cargado.

Pestaña de datos

Pulsando la pestaña Gráfico, visualizará el grafo correspondiente a la ruta solución del problema. Por ejemplo, para los datos anteriores, obtendrá:

Pestaña de gráfico 

En cada uno de los nodos, estará escrito el nombre de cada una las ciudades.

Por último, si pulsa la pestaña Solución, obtendrá la ruta solución del problema, ordenadas en la secuencia de visita.

Junto a la ruta, obtendrá el coste óptimo que nos da el Problema del Viajante de Comercio para nuestro conjunto de ciudades y distancias.

En el caso de que se tratase de un problema sin solución, la aplicación no devolverá ninguna solución, lo cuál se debe interpretar como que no existe una ruta entre las ciudades introducidas, o bien, podría modificar el conjunto de datos como se ha explicado anteriormente.

Pestaña de solución
Última modificación: martes, 7 de julio de 2015, 20:59